#0d3507 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0d3507 is composed of 5.1% red, 20.8%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.8%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 112.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 11.8%. #0d3507 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a6a0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#0d3507

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f1fdef is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d3507

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1c201c is the less saturated color, while #083c00 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#0d3507 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#242424 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#1f271e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#3e3811 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#453518 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#253b3f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#2c370d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#303512 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#1c392b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
